Futura

The Stovax Futura 5 multifuel and corner wood burning stove burning stove is DEFRA exempted for Smoke Control Areas, Eco-design Plus Ready. It has a large view window and stylish stainless steel air control. This contemporary design is ideal for both modern and traditional homes. It also has a convector heating system that is state-of-the art with heat shields built-in to maximize the amount of heat that is returned to the space.

Stovax Studio stoves are freestanding wood burner models that offer the performance of inset wood burning fires however in a stand-alone style. This stunning collection features widescreen flames that can be combined by a variety of styles and Contemporary Wood burners frames for an elegant living room design. All models are equipped with Stovax's technologically advanced Cleanburn combustion systems, which direct three types of air into the glass-fronted firebox to deliver high efficiency in heating, superior flame control, and stunning widescreen views of the flames.

Studio Air 2 includes an air kit for external use that reduces the minimum distance between combustibles within Smoke Control Areas. Both models can be paired with a range of highly effective heat shields to further reduce clearance requirements, thus allowing possibilities for installation and creating a dramatic style statement.
